在网页设计中,表单是用户与网站交互的重要方式。而layui作为一个流行的前端UI框架,提供了丰富的组件和功能,其中表单组件更是方便开发者快速搭建美观、实用的表单。本文将详细介绍如何在layui中设置表单宽度,以及如何打造响应式表单,让你的网站更加美观。
一、layui表单宽度设置
layui提供了多种方式来设置表单宽度,以下是一些常用的方法:
1. 使用class类
layui为表单提供了.layui-form类,你可以通过添加不同的class类来设置表单宽度。
全宽表单:只需在表单元素上添加
.layui-form类即可实现全宽表单。<form class="layui-form"> <!-- 表单内容 --> </form>固定宽度表单:在
.layui-form类的基础上,添加.layui-form-inline类,并设置style属性来指定宽度。<form class="layui-form layui-form-inline" style="width: 600px;"> <!-- 表单内容 --> </form>
2. 使用栅格系统
layui的栅格系统可以方便地实现响应式布局,你可以使用栅格系统来设置表单宽度。
一行一列:使用栅格系统的一行一列布局。
<div class="layui-row"> <div class="layui-col-md12"> <form class="layui-form"> <!-- 表单内容 --> </form> </div> </div>多列布局:使用栅格系统的多列布局。
<div class="layui-row"> <div class="layui-col-md6"> <form class="layui-form"> <!-- 表单内容 --> </form> </div> <div class="layui-col-md6"> <form class="layui-form"> <!-- 表单内容 --> </form> </div> </div>
二、响应式表单
响应式表单是指在不同设备上都能保持良好展示效果的表单。以下是一些实现响应式表单的方法:
1. 使用栅格系统
如前所述,layui的栅格系统可以帮助你实现响应式布局。通过调整栅格系统的列宽,可以适应不同屏幕尺寸。
2. 使用媒体查询
媒体查询是一种CSS技术,可以根据不同屏幕尺寸应用不同的样式。在layui中,你可以使用媒体查询来调整表单宽度。
@media (max-width: 768px) {
.layui-form {
width: 100%;
}
}
3. 使用layui内置的响应式组件
layui内置了一些响应式组件,如layui-laydate日期选择器、layui-upload文件上传等。使用这些组件可以确保表单在不同设备上都能正常显示。
三、总结
学会layui表单宽度设置和响应式设计,可以帮助你轻松打造美观、实用的表单。通过以上方法,你可以根据实际需求调整表单宽度,并使其在不同设备上保持良好展示效果。希望本文能对你有所帮助!
